About

Angela Star Meyer Goebel is a criminal defense attorney with 6 years of legal experience, practicing at Meyer Goebel Law, LLC in Cincinnati, OH. She attended Northern Kentucky University, Salmon P. Chase College of Law and Northern Kentucky University. She has been admitted to the Ohio Bar since 2020. Her practice encompasses criminal defense, estate planning, family, and juvenile law, allowing her to serve clients across a range of legal needs. She ma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
